The flight in the ATR 72 began with a 14-minute taxi from the parking area to the runway, covering a distance of 2 nm. The departure took place on runway 14 at EGNM Leeds Bradford Airport, with a takeoff distance of 592 m, which was 36% of the runway length. The liftoff speed was recorded at 108 knots. The local weather at the time of departure was 3°C with a wind speed of 2 knots coming from 230°, resulting in a crosswind of 2 knots and a headwind of 0 knots.
The enroute climb commenced over Horsforth in Leeds, England, with the aircraft ascending from 1,629 ft above sea level to 17,337 ft, covering a distance of 15 nm in 10 minutes. The enroute level cruise started 3 miles east of Colne in Lancashire, England, lasting 22 minutes and covering a distance of 77 nm.
The enroute descent began 16 miles southeast of Douglas on the Isle of Man, with the aircraft descending from 17,913 ft to 1,803 ft in 14 minutes, covering a distance of 12 nm. The landing occurred on runway 26 at EGNS Isle of Man Airport, with a runway length of 1,524 m. The height at threshold was 41 ft above ground level, and the speed at threshold was 105 knots. The touchdown was 300 m from the threshold, with a touchdown speed of 100 knots and a Vertical Speed Indicator (VSI) reading of -371 ft/min. The local weather at the time of landing was 4°C, with a wind speed of 2 knots from 350°, resulting in a crosswind of 1 knot and a headwind of 0 knots. The total landing distance was 600 m, equivalent to 39% of the runway length.
After landing, the aircraft taxied to the parking area from the runway in 4 minutes, covering less than 1 nm. The total flight distance covered was 120 nm over a duration of 65 minutes, consuming 43 kg of fuel.
